NotePad++ is a wonderful editor that I don' want to miss any more. Just a short hint what can be improved:
N++ is trying to restore the old screen position that it had when it was closed for the last time. This goes wrong in the following case: I used to have two monitors and opened N++ on the second one. Some day I had to turn off the second monitor and N++ did not appear on the screen any more, except in maximized mode. So I would suggest to implement a check on startup, whether the stored position is valid, before overtaking it. Thank you! :-)

I have the same problem with dual screen... A solution has already be posted here http://sourceforge.net/forum/message.php?msg_id=4271040
The solution is "open the "config.xml" file (either in the Notepad++ install directory or in %APPDATA%/Notepad++) in regular Notepad, change the AppPosition's "x" value to "0", and save. Re-open Notepad++ and it will be left-justified on your primary screen."
